News

The Current Radar map shows areas of current precipitation (rain, mixed, or snow). The map can be animated to show the previous one hour of radar.
The National Hurricane Center has already announced more than a few changes it’s making for the upcoming hurricane season, like updating its “cone of uncertainty” and providing an earlier window to ...